How to fill out the USCIS I-601A online

The USCIS I-601A form, also known as the application for provisional unlawful presence waiver, is essential for individuals seeking to waive grounds of inadmissibility based on their unlawful presence in the United States. This guide provides clear, step-by-step instructions to assist you in filling out the form online.

Follow the steps to accurately complete the form.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it.
  2. Fill out Part 1, which requests information about the applicant. Start by entering your full name, including family name, given name, and middle name. Then, provide your Alien Registration Number (if applicable) and your U.S. Social Security Number (optional).
  3. Complete the address sections, including your home address and mailing address if different. Ensure that the street number, city, state, and zip code are accurately filled.
  4. In Part 1, continue filling in your contact information by providing a daytime phone number and email address, if applicable.
  5. Detail your birth and citizenship information in the subsequent fields, including your date of birth, city and country of birth, as well as your country of citizenship.
  6. Respond to questions related to your immigration status and any previous entries by providing the necessary details about your last entry into the United States.
  7. In Part 2, provide information about your immediate relative petition and immigrant visa processing, specifying whether a U.S. Embassy or consulate initially acted on your case.
  8. Fill out Part 3, providing details about your qualifying relative who would face extreme hardship if your application were denied. Include their full name and relationship to you.
  9. In Part 4, take the opportunity to explain why your application should be approved, detailing any extreme hardship your qualifying relatives might encounter.
  10. If necessary, use Part 5 for any additional information. You can attach extra sheets if you require more space, ensuring your name and applicable section references are included.
  11. Sign and date your application in Part 6, certifying that all the information is true to the best of your knowledge.
  12. If applicable, fill out Part 7 regarding the contact information of the person who prepared your application.
  13. Lastly, save the changes you have made, and choose to download, print, or share your completed form as needed.

Individuals who may qualify for the USCIS I-601A waiver typically include those who are immediate relatives of U.S. citizens or lawful permanent residents. You must be ineligible to adjust status due to unlawful presence but face extreme hardship if you remain separated from your qualifying relative. When submitting the USCIS I-601A form, required evidence includes proof of your qualifying relative’s citizenship or lawful status, documentation showing your relationship, and comprehensive evidence of extreme hardship. To prove extreme hardship for your USCIS I-601A application, you need to provide personal testimonies, medical records, financial statements, and any other relevant documentation. This evidence should clearly illustrate how denying the waiver would negatively impact you or your family. A well-structured presentation of your case can greatly enhance your application’s success.
